SI® Solid Body Press-In Insert

Superior Threaded Connections in Plastics Applications
Creating reliable threaded connections in plastic components demands a fastener that delivers on both pullout strength and torque resistance without complex installation requirements. The new SI® Solid Body Press-In Insert with Retention Fin Design provides exceptional performance where it’s needed most.
This non-slotted, cold press insert features an innovative approach that outperforms standard press-in inserts – creating strong, reusable threads without requiring heat or ultrasonics for installation.

Exceptional Performance from Unique Retention Fin Design
The SI® Solid Body Press-In Insert delivers exceptional performance metrics that provide secure connections in your most demanding applications:
- Retention Fin/Barbed Feature provides significantly better pullout performance than other solid body press-in inserts on the market
- Pullout values in ABS plastic reaching up to 142 lbs. for larger sizes
- Torque-out values exceeding 36 in. lbs.

Simple 3-Step Installation
Installing the SI® Solid Body Press-In Insert is straightforward and efficient. No specialized equipment or complex methods are required – just a standard arbor press – saving time and reducing costs while providing consistent, reliable results.
Step 1.
Prepare properly sized mounting hole (molded holes preferred for dimensional accuracy)
Step 2.
Align and orient the fastener in the mounting hole
Step 3.
Apply appropriate pressure until the fastener is fully seated

SI® Solid Body Press-In Insert At-a-Glance
- Retention Fin/Barbed Feature significantly improves pullout resistance compared to standard press-in inserts
- Right-Handed Knurls cut directly into host material for superior torque resistance
- Cold Press Installation eliminates need for ultrasonic or heat insertion equipment
- Material Versatility with brass, stainless steel, and aluminum options
- Comprehensive Size Range in both inch and metric thread sizes
- Multiple Configuration Options including standard straight wall installation designs (IPA/IPB/IPC) and flanged-head designs for higher tensile pull loads in reverse entry applications (IPFA/IPFB/IPFC)
